### Runbook: Gatekeep rate limiting

Symptom: 429s spiking on internal routes through the Gatekeep gateway. First check the `burst-global` bucket in the Gatekeep dashboard; if saturation is above 90%, bump the tenant's quota via the admin API rather than restarting pods. Restarting resets counters and masks the problem. Quota changes take effect within one minute. Escalate to the platform channel if limits reset on their own. The admin API authenticates with the key below.

gateway credential: qvz7-vWy80ME

**Action Item AI-7: Shard Nestline profile store**

Owner: platform team. Split the Nestline user-profile store into region-keyed shards to cap blast radius from the outage. Security review required before cutover: verify per-shard encryption keys and access scoping. Target: end of next sprint. Sharding design and key-management plan are on the internal page.

dashboard of bafof-hafog = https://confluence.lumiclabs.internal/display/browse/display/6a09a20a

**Q: Why does PortionPal round some scaled ingredients weirdly?**

Good question! When you scale a recipe past 4x, PortionPal switches from fraction mode to decimal mode, which can look odd for things like eggs. It's intentional, not a bug, so don't file tickets for it. The full rounding rules live on our internal wiki page.

dashboard of yafog-fajof = https://jira.tolvaqsys.internal/pages/pages/projects/49fe21c4

Welcome to the Varnholt platform team. Our load balancer, Glimmeract, probes each node's /healthz endpoint every ten seconds; three consecutive failures remove a node from rotation. Please verify the probe also checks database reachability, not just process liveness, before deploying. To run the health check locally, you will need the staging connection string below.

replica DSN, kajep-yahag: mssql://praok_svc:iF@db-8d68.plorvaio.local:5432/eliion